WebJan 13, 2024 · The white portion of the eyeball is called the sclera. Conjunctivitis is an infection or an allergic inflammation of the conjunctiva and the sclera. Though infection and allergies both cause the eyes to turn red or pink, it is essential to know why they are different. Allergic conjunctivitis happens due to inflammation of the conjunctiva. WebOct 29, 2024 · Pink eye is actually an infection that may either be caused by bacteria or a virus. Allergies, on the other hand, are triggered by such irritants as pets or pollen. WebBacterial pink eye can be treated with antibiotics prescribed by a doctor. To reduce the symptoms of bacterial or viral pink eye you can: Take ibuprofen or another over-the-counter pain killer. Use over-the-counter lubricating eye drops (artificial tears). Put a warm, damp washcloth over your eyes for a few minutes. To make this warm compress:

The pink or reddish color is a result of the inflammation of the conjunctiva, which is the clear, thin membrane that lines the inside of the eyelid and white portion of the eyeball.
